Malaysia Negeri Sembilan Delegation Visits Antmed, Ushering in a New Chapter of China-Malaysia Medical Cooperation

source:Antmed 2025-06-05

On May 27, 2025, the Chief Minister of Negeri Sembilan, Malaysia, Dato' Seri Haji Aminuddin Bin Harun, led government delegation to visit Antmed’s Songshan Lake campus. The delegation toured the company’s showroom, automated production workshops, and supporting facilities, and engaged in in-depth discussions on the medical device industry, cutting-edge technologies, and industrial investment opportunities.

Accompanied by Mr. Wang Wuxing, Chairman of Antmed, and the company’s management team, the delegation first visited Antmed’s digital showroom. Through immersive and interactive experiences, the visitors gained a comprehensive understanding of Antmed’s achievements in the high-end medical device sector. They expressed high recognition of the company’s integrated “R&D–Manufacturing–Service” model.

The delegation then toured Antmed’s automated and digitalized production workshops, where they observed the lean manufacturing process firsthand. The visit left a strong impression on the delegation.

During a dedicated symposium, the delegation praised the construction progress of Antmed’s manufacturing project in Port Dickson, expressing full support for its early completion and commencement of operations. They also pledged to assist Antmed in establishing an overseas expansion center. The delegation introduced Negeri Sembilan’s investment environment and incentive policies, and the Chief Minister expressed hope that Antmed would lead more advanced medical enterprises to invest in Malaysia, bringing in valuable R&D, manufacturing, and management experience to upgrade the state’s medical industry.
